The Monumental Classical Winged Angel Bronze Fountain stands at a commanding 300cm, presenting a full-striding celestial figure with wings swept dramatically upward and outward, robes caught mid-flow across the body, and one arm extended downward in a gesture of offering or protection. This is a sculpture built for permanence, presence, and awe.
Cast using the traditional lost-wax method, every surface of this piece carries the integrity of hand-finished cast bronze. The figure is worked in smooth bronze across the robes, wings, and face, then treated to a deep grey-green weathered patina that reads as both timeless and organic in outdoor light. This is the finish of civic monuments and grand estate gardens: consistent, dignified, and built to deepen with age. Whether positioned against a clipped yew hedge, a stone balustrade, or the open sky above a formal pool, the patina anchors the piece with classical authority.
The integrated multi-tiered fountain base allows water to cascade from beneath the figure, animating the surrounding space with sound and movement. This combination of monumental figurative sculpture and functional water feature makes it equally suited to formal garden axes, estate courtyards, public plaza commissions, and resort landscaping. The scale demands open space and a clear sightline; it repays both with something few garden ornaments can offer: genuine sculptural gravitas.
Patina options include warm golden brown, verdigris green, dark oxidised black, and natural polished bronze. The scale can be adjusted for specific site requirements.
